2009 Commemorates A Century Of Dedication!

CLICK to make a DONATIONTwo thousand nine marks the 100th anniversary of the FSU's Alumni Association.

 

 

 

 Members, friends and special guests travelled from Miami, Tampa, Jacksonville and other parts of the country rallying together in record numbers to participate in the 6th Annual Alumni Cup Golf Tournament held at the Don Veller Seminole Golf Course and Club on October 9th in Tallahassee, Florida.

Play began at 8:30 am and though the course was extremely foggy, all were in high spirits after being able to warm-up by hitting a few practice balls on the range and putting greens. Everyone was in their carts, ready to go, when the starter sounded the alarm. President/CEO Scott Atwellof the FSU Alumni Association gave the commencement address thanking all the sponsors and players for their generosity in supporting such a worthy cause.
